🏠 Nearly 200 NS families just gained long-term housing security
Rooted secured $7M to purchase:
πŸ“ 3 Dartmouth properties (Primrose St, Franklyn Court)
πŸ“ 3 Truro properties (Park St, Minerva Dr)
30-year affordability commitment = no displacement, stable rents

Halifax economy 2025: βœ… 2.6% GDP growth (2nd among major cities) βœ… 13,900 new jobs (record gain) βœ… Inflation down to 1.7% βœ… 4,657 housing starts βœ… 5.6% unemployment The numbers tell a story of resilient growth. Full breakdown: shorturl.at/yj5ok #HalifaxEconomy #NovaScotia
